Party Spit Hire has standard, large and extra-large charcoal roasters suited to different whole-pig weights. Tell us the pig weight, whether you are sourcing it yourself and what else you hope to cook.
We publish the equipment hire price for each roaster. Whole-pig supply, delivery, collection and optional cooking are quoted for the actual event rather than charged per person.
The 1 metre roaster supports a whole pig up to 12kg. Hire price: $130 plus a $50 refundable deposit.
The 1.2 metre roaster supports a whole pig up to 20kg. Hire price: $160 plus a $60 refundable deposit.
The 1.5 metre roaster supports a whole pig up to 30kg. Hire price: $175 plus a $70 refundable deposit.
A whole pig generally occupies the full spit. Additional meats or gyros require a second roaster.
If Party Spit Hire supplies the whole pig, it arrives fitted to the spit rod with the required brackets. This removes the job of arranging the mounting with a butcher.
If you are sourcing your own pig, confirm the dressed weight and mounting requirements before booking. Send those details with your quote request so we can recommend a suitable roaster and accessories.
The roaster hire prices are published on the website. A whole-pig order is quoted as a fixed event order based on the supplied pig, equipment, delivery and collection requirements.
On-site cooking and carving can be added if you would rather have Party Spit Hire manage the charcoal, rotation and serving-time plan. The cooking service is also quoted for the event, not per person.
